Hi all, hoping for some guidance on a PCN I've received as the hirer of the vehicle.

The PCN was issued by APCOA Parking, dated 11th March 2026, for alleged use of the Pick Up / Drop Off Zone at Manchester Airport Terminal 2 West, Ground Floor, without making a valid payment. The alleged breach was 20th February 2026, entry at 16:09 and exit at 16:12 — a stay of approximately 3 minutes. The charge is £100, reduced to £60 if paid within 14 days of issue.

When the driver realised payment hadn't been made, they attempted to pay retrospectively approximately 36 hours after the incident. However, the payment system would not facilitate a late payment. The airport was also contacted directly, but confirmed there was nothing they could do.
The notice was then sent to the registered keeper's address rather than directly to me as hirer, and was passed on to me with some delay — meaning the early payment window had already closed by the time I received it, through no fault of my own.

I have not yet responded to APCOA or made any payment. I'd welcome advice on the best grounds for appeal, particularly given the very short duration of the stop (3 minutes), the good-faith attempt to pay retrospectively, and the delay in receiving the notice.

Did you receive any other documents with the PCN?  Probably not, so there are 2 points of appeal:

1.  They have failed to issue the correct documentation to allow transfer to hirer
2.  The airport is not relevant land for the purposes of POFA, so they cannot transfer liability from the driver in any case.

So as long as you don't tell them who was driving, they have no way of enforcing it.
